It is our pleasure to highlight the missionary activities of our Diocesan Missionary Prayer Band.  In response to the Great commission of our Lord and Saviour Jesus Christ, "Go ye into all the world and preach the Gospel to every creature" (MK 16:15), the DMPB is serving the Lord for the past 40 years in some of the unreached areas of our land. It is rendering fruitful services to the under-previleged and down trodden tribals of the hilly regions and the most backward areas of Tamil Nadu and other parts of India

Our Missionaries are staying with these people, providing health care by establishing hospitals and other health centres.  We are providing literacy to the adults and also we have been providing education to the children in our Nursery, Primary, High and Higher Secondary Schools.  A few hostels are also established for the tribal children in these areas. The need for Technical Institutions to offer job oriented courses for these children is highly felt and we are praying and planning for the same.   We have already started some tailoring institutes for these poor tribal women.   Sunday worships and other special meetings are being conducted in these  areas.

We receive the needed financial assistance and prayer support from the members of our congregations.  Many committed young men and women have come forward to serve in these areas as missionaries,teachers,wardens, medical missionaries etc.  Still, there are many unreached villages around our mission fields and the needs to these neglected people are many fold.  We request the earnest prayers of the well wishers for these ventures and seek participation, both physically and financially, as the Lord leads you.
